| Doc Text: |
This release improves deployment adaptability by now allowing you to change the hostname used in the Domain Remapping feature (via cname_lookup). In doing so, CDN links can persist through changes in either hosting structure or providers.
With this, you can now freely use the CNAME feature of DNS in the presence of domain_remap middleware.
